10 day trip starting Friday 27th May. Route M6 - M74 - A70 to Ardrossan - ferry to Arran - ferry to Mull of Kintyre- ferry to Islay Sample some usquebaugh. Ferry to Oban - A828 To Fort William -A82 - Invergarry A87 to Kyle of Lochalsh - A890 - A896 over the Bealach to Applecross around Coast road to Sheildaig - Achnasheen - Ullapool - Achiltibuie - Inverness - A9 - M74 - M6 - M54.
Will have some room if required.
